topper

Betekenis (English)

  1. Something that is on top.
  2. A top hat.
  3. Something that exceeds those previous in a series, as a joke or prank.
  4. A short outer jacket worn by women or children.
  5. A soft, relatively thin, piece of padding placed on top of a mattress, or forming the upper layer of a mattress.
  6. The student who achieves the highest score in an examination.
  7. (colloquial) The head or chief of an organization.
  8. A person or tool that cuts off the top of something.
  9. One who tops steel ingots.
  10. A single-handed dinghy, 11 foot (3.6 metres) in length, with only one sail.
  11. A three-square float, or file, used by comb-makers.
  12. (slang) Tobacco left in the bottom of a pipe bowl; so called from being often taken out and placed on top of the newly filled bowl.
  13. (slang) A fine or remarkable thing or person.
  14. (slang) A blow on the head.
  15. A small secondary comic strip seen along with a larger Sunday strip, and usually by the same author.
  16. A pencil sharpener.
